WebThe earliest keys are those which operated the Egyptian pin tumbler locks from about 4,000 years ago. Information about these is provided in several books dealing with the history of locks and keys, so we will commence … WebThe Egyptian lock was first described by Eton in his Survey of the Turkish Empire, 1798. Further information about it was given early in the 19th century by Denon, the Frenchman, who said that he had found the locks sculptured in one of the grand old temples of Karnac, which shows that the same kind of lock has served Egypt for 40 centuries. Log in Explore Education 10 Egyptian symbols wallpaper background lock screen ancient Egypt WebThe Romans’ metal pin tumbler locks evolved out of the Egyptian wooden locks. They were often small masterpieces in precision and design. The keys were usually made of bronze and iron, but sometimes of precious metals, and were worn on the fingers as rings.
